APA's latest Stress in America survey finds concerns about the future of the country are weighing heavily on the minds of many Americans. Murphy Psychological Services is expanding! Excited to introduce two new pre-licensed mental health counselors who are joining the practice this month.

Melissa Charron Jarest, M.A., is a clinical mental health counselor (under supervision) and certified life coach offering telehealth services to adults navigating seasons of change. Whether you're feeling stuck, overwhelmed, or uncertain about your next steps, Melissa provides a safe and supportive space to reconnect with your inner strength and clarity. Her work centers on whole-person wellness, emphasizing the connection between mind and body for meaningful, lasting healing.

Melissa specializes in self-worth and self-esteem, life transitions, and goal setting for personal growth. Her approach is warm, compassionate, and client-centered, blending clinical training with life coaching techniques, mindfulness practices, somatic awareness, and practical tools to support each journey

Filiz Wright, EdS.., is a pre-licensed mental health clinician and school psychologist who provides counseling for children, adolescents, and adults navigating anxiety, depression, trauma, emotional regulation challenges, ADHD, and learning differences.

Her counseling approach is relational, evidence-based, and integrative, grounded in an understanding that each individual’s story and development are unique. Filiz draws on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), play therapy, and person-centered, nervous-system-informed interventions to foster emotional awareness, coping skills, and resilience. With years of experience in schools and community settings, Filiz is passionate about helping clients build regulation, confidence, and connection within themselves and their relationships. Her practice is guided by warmth, curiosity, and collaboration, meeting each client where they are and supporting growth at their own pace.

Outside of her work, Filiz enjoys spending time outdoors with her family, hiking, and camping across New England. She also speaks Turkish and values bringing a multicultural perspective to her practice.
